Arsen Julfalakyan Takes Part in Tournament After Long Break and Wins It

Arsen Julfalakyan, Olympic Games London 2012 silver medalist, world and European champion, took part in a Greco-Roman wrestling pan-Russian tournament held in Adygea, Russia and was named its winner. The 32-year-old wrestler spent four bouts and won with the following scores 6։3, 4։0, 8։0, 6։4.

In a conversation with the ANOC press service Arsen Julfalakyan noted that it was hard to participate in such a tournament after a 7-month break.

“I felt some lack of training practice. My rivals were high-class wrestlers, prize winners of the Russian Championship. I think I needed that tournament to understand my present physical condition and what gaps I should work on,” Arsen Julfalakyan said.
The tournament which was held from 9-10 November, was attended by wrestlers from Russia and Kyrgyzstan. Arsen Julfalakyan was the only Armenian representative there.
